GD Resources LLC is seeking a Board-Certified Radiology Physician to provide (teleradiology) services to patients of the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), supporting the Asheville VA Medical Center in Asheville.
The selected contractor will deliver high-quality diagnostic interpretations across multiple imaging modalities while adhering to the standards set by the American College of Radiology and all VA regulatory and credentialing requirements.
